
拷贝xls怎么转换成excel:使用兼容性模式、通过另存为功能、使用Excel打开并保存。 在这篇文章中,我们将详细探讨如何将旧版的XLS文件转换为现代的Excel格式(XLSX),并介绍几种方法以确保数据的完整性和格式的保留。
一、使用兼容性模式
什么是兼容性模式?
兼容性模式是Microsoft Excel中的一种功能,使旧版Excel文件(.xls)可以在新的Excel版本中打开和编辑,而不会丢失原有的格式和数据。这个功能特别适用于那些需要在多个版本的Excel中工作的人。
如何使用兼容性模式?
- 打开文件:在Excel中打开你需要转换的XLS文件。这时,Excel会自动进入兼容性模式。
- 编辑和保存:你可以在兼容性模式下编辑文件,完成后直接保存。如果需要转换成XLSX格式,可以通过“另存为”功能来完成。
兼容性模式的优点:
- 不需要额外的软件或插件。
- 能够保留原有的格式和数据。
兼容性模式的缺点:
- 某些新功能可能无法使用。
- 文件大小可能较大,不如XLSX格式高效。
二、通过另存为功能
另存为功能介绍
另存为功能是将当前文件保存为另一种格式的常用方法。在Excel中,你可以轻松地将XLS文件另存为XLSX格式。
如何使用另存为功能?
- 打开文件:在Excel中打开需要转换的XLS文件。
- 文件菜单:点击左上角的“文件”菜单。
- 另存为:选择“另存为”选项。
- 选择格式:在“保存类型”下拉菜单中选择“Excel 工作簿 (*.xlsx)”。
另存为功能的优点:
- 简单快捷。
- 能够保留大部分格式和数据。
另存为功能的缺点:
- 需要手动操作,不适合批量转换。
三、使用Excel打开并保存
直接打开并保存
这种方法与使用兼容性模式类似,但更直接。你只需在Excel中打开XLS文件,然后保存为XLSX格式即可。
如何操作?
- 打开文件:在Excel中打开需要转换的XLS文件。
- 保存文件:点击左上角的“文件”菜单,选择“另存为”选项。
- 选择格式:在“保存类型”下拉菜单中选择“Excel 工作簿 (*.xlsx)”。
直接打开并保存的优点:
- 操作简单。
- 能够保留大部分格式和数据。
直接打开并保存的缺点:
- 需要手动操作,不适合批量转换。
四、使用第三方工具
第三方工具介绍
市面上有许多第三方工具可以帮助你将XLS文件转换为XLSX格式。这些工具通常拥有更高级的功能,如批量转换和格式优化。
常用的第三方工具
- Online Convert:一个在线转换工具,支持多种文件格式的转换。
- Zamzar:另一个在线转换工具,支持批量转换。
- FileZigZag:支持多种文件格式的在线转换工具。
第三方工具的优点:
- 支持批量转换。
- 有些工具提供格式优化功能。
第三方工具的缺点:
- 可能需要付费订阅。
- 数据安全性需要考量。
五、使用宏和VBA脚本
宏和VBA脚本介绍
如果你需要批量转换多个XLS文件,可以使用Excel中的宏和VBA脚本。通过编写脚本,可以自动完成文件的转换过程。
如何编写VBA脚本?
- 打开Excel:在Excel中按ALT + F11打开VBA编辑器。
- 编写脚本:在模块中粘贴以下脚本:
Sub ConvertXLSToXLSX()
Dim wb As Workbook
Dim strPath As String
Dim strFile As String
strPath = "C:pathtoyourfolder"
strFile = Dir(strPath & "*.xls")
Do While strFile <> ""
Set wb = Workbooks.Open(strPath & strFile)
wb.SaveAs strPath & Replace(strFile, ".xls", ".xlsx"), FileFormat:=51
wb.Close False
strFile = Dir
Loop
End Sub
- 运行脚本:按F5运行脚本,Excel会自动将指定文件夹中的所有XLS文件转换为XLSX格式。
使用宏和VBA脚本的优点:
- 支持批量转换。
- 自动化程度高。
使用宏和VBA脚本的缺点:
- 需要一定的编程知识。
- 可能会遇到兼容性问题。
六、注意事项
数据完整性
在转换过程中,确保数据的完整性是非常重要的。建议在转换前备份原始文件,并在转换后检查文件中的数据和格式是否正确。
文件大小
XLSX格式通常比XLS格式的文件小,因为XLSX使用了更高效的压缩算法。如果文件大小是一个重要因素,建议转换为XLSX格式。
兼容性
虽然XLSX是现代Excel文件的标准格式,但某些旧版软件和系统可能不支持。因此,在转换前,确保你的工作环境和软件能够兼容XLSX格式。
七、总结
将XLS文件转换为XLSX文件有多种方法,包括使用兼容性模式、通过另存为功能、直接打开并保存、使用第三方工具和编写宏和VBA脚本。每种方法都有其优点和缺点,选择哪种方法取决于你的具体需求和技术水平。总之,确保数据的完整性和格式的保留是转换过程中最重要的考虑因素。
相关问答FAQs:
1. 如何将XLS文件转换为Excel文件?
- Q: 我有一个XLS文件,想把它转换成Excel文件,应该怎么做?
- A: 您可以使用Microsoft Excel软件来打开和转换XLS文件。只需打开Excel软件,然后点击菜单栏中的“文件”选项,选择“打开”并浏览到您的XLS文件所在的位置。选择文件后,Excel将自动将其转换为Excel文件格式并打开。
2. 我的XLS文件无法在Excel中打开,有什么解决方法?
- Q: 我尝试使用Excel打开我的XLS文件时,遇到了问题,它无法打开。有什么解决方法?
- A: 如果您的XLS文件无法在Excel中打开,可能是由于文件损坏或格式不受支持所致。您可以尝试以下解决方法:
- 确保您使用的是最新版本的Excel软件。
- 尝试从备份或其他来源获取另一个副本,以查看是否是文件本身的问题。
- 尝试使用其他电子表格软件(如Google Sheets)打开XLS文件,并将其另存为Excel文件格式。
- 如果以上方法都无效,您可以尝试使用在线文件转换工具将XLS文件转换为Excel文件。
3. 如何将XLS文件转换为Excel文件以便在不同版本的Excel中使用?
- Q: 我想将我的XLS文件转换为Excel文件,以便在不同版本的Excel中使用,应该怎么做?
- A: 要将XLS文件转换为Excel文件以便在不同版本的Excel中使用,您可以按照以下步骤操作:
- 打开XLS文件并在Excel中进行编辑。
- 点击菜单栏中的“文件”选项,选择“另存为”。
- 在保存对话框中,选择所需的Excel文件格式(如XLSX或XLSM)。
- 确定保存位置和文件名,并点击“保存”按钮。
这样,您就可以将XLS文件转换为Excel文件,并在不同版本的Excel中使用了。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4257666